Job description

AI Engineers, Inc. (AIE) is looking for a Structural Engineer, Team Leader to join our Bridge Inspection and Design teams based in New York, NY. This is an immediate opening for an enthusiastic, highly-organized bridge inspection engineering professional to lead inspections, with the option to assist with load rating and design on new projects. The ideal candidate should possess a “can-do” attitude, excellent verbal and written communication skills, and an ability to work independently as well as with a team in a dynamic, fast-paced, and innovative consulting firm. This position includes opportunities for personal and professional development and growth.

AIE's industry-leading compensation/benefits package features company-paid HSA contributions, 401k match, competitive PTO package, ESOP program, mentorship and advancement opportunities, and flexible work environment. Our top-tier benefits programs reflect our passion and culture for investing in our people.

Requirements/Qualifications
  •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ering required
  • P.E. license in NY, required (NJ P.E. license is a plus)
  • 5+ years of bridge inspection experience
  • Must have completed the NHI two (2) week Bridge Inspector training course and/or NHI Bridge Inspection Refresher course within the last 5 years.
  • Experience with Microsoft Office, MicroStation, and CombIS (Bentley AssetWise).
  • Bridge load rating and experience with LARS and/or AASHTOWare BrR is a plus.
  • NHI course for NSTM/FCM, Scour, LRFR load rating, and Ancillary Highway Structure inspection is a plus.
Responsibilities
  • Bridge, tunnel, and ancillary structure inspections and load ratings
  • Preparing scheduling, writing inspection reports, assuring QA/QC, and assist with project coordination
  • Perform structural analyses, develop calculations, and prepare plans in accordance with federal, state, and local agency requirements.
  • Prepare quantities, cost estimates, and special provisions.
  • Site visits and onsite structure inspections.
  • Assist project managers with assignments including schedule and budget updates and proposal preparation
  • Perform engineering tasks related to bridge design projects and other transportation-related structural design and analysis projects as time allows
  • Design steel, concrete, and/or timber bridge elements, walls, and associated structures as time allows

AIE is a multi-disciplinary, ENR-500 company with 13 offices in the U.S and over 350 employees. We are an engineering consulting firm providing Bridge, Transportation, Construction Engineering, Water/Wastewater, Site/Civil, Building Systems, Design-Build, Survey/Mapping, and Technology services to public and private clients nationwide. Design, Analysis, Inspection & Evaluation are among the core expertise of the firm, earning us a national reputationforserving on major projects in over 20 states. AIE integrates advanced equipment and technology into our infrastructure engineering services, including drones,laser scanning, artificial intelligence, and point-cloud mapping.
